Additional External Component Cores

– “External Component Cores” that enhance the performances of External Components have been added.

– External Components of “Ultimate” Tier or higher have theirs Core unlocked and do not require Core Unlocking.

– You may equip External Component Cores by using Albion’s “Core Crafting Bench” once reaching Mastery Rank 8.

– Crafting and conversion of existing Cores are not available at “Core Crafting Bench” once you reach Mastery Rank 8.

– All External Components have two Core Slots and each of them have assigned Augment Types.

ㄴ You can only equip a Core Slot with the same Augment type of External Component Core Items, and options are granted once it’s equipped.

– External Components of Ultimate tier of higher can equip External Component Cores.

ㄴ When an External Component Core is equipped, a random option is granted per the Augment type.

– External Component Core items have stages, marked with Roman numerals (e.g., I, II, III, etc.). The higher the stage, the better the option effect values they provide.

ㄴ Each option has a fixed value range based on the External Component Core item’s stage, and the final value is randomly determined within that range.

– An External Component Core that is equipped to a Core Slot may be replaced with another one.

ㄴ To change an External Component Core, a “Core Particle Disruptor” item is required, just as for a Weapon Core.

ㄴ When replacing an External Component Core, you may choose from the existing effects and the new effects. If you do not like the new effects, choose to keep the existing one.

ㄴ If you decide to keep the existing effects, the External Component Core and Core Particle Disruptor spent for the replacement are not returned.

– You may craft External Component Cores at a Core Crafting Bench.

ㄴ To craft an External Component Core, a “Core Amplifier” is needed, just as for a Weapon Core.

– You may convert External Component Cores at a Core Crafting Bench.

ㄴ You may convert Stage 10 External Component Cores, just as for Weapon Cores.

– External Component Core items can be acquired from the “400% Infiltration Operation” and “Sigma Sector Dropoff Operation.”

ㄴ Sigma Sector Dropoff Operation Normal Stage 1-8

ㄴ Infiltration Operation: Hard 400% Stage 2-10

ㄴ Sigma Sector Dropoff Operation High-risk Stage 3-10

 

Additional Weapon Core

– “Hit Augmentation Core (Variant AB)” that can be equipped to a Weapon’s Hit Augmentation Slot has been added.

– You can choose to equip or replace the existing “Hit Augmentation Core” or the new “Hit Augmentation Core (Variant AB)” to the Hit Augmentation Slot.

ㄴ You can replace an existing Core equipped to a slot with a “Hit Augmentation Core (Variant AB),” and vice versa.

– “Hit Augmentation Core (Variant AB)” can be crafted and converted.

– Hit Augmentation Core (Variant AB) can be acquired from Void Erosion Purge, just as other Weapon Cores.

ㄴ Hit Augmentation Cores (Variant AB) with different Stages have been added to Mission Completion Rewards.

ㄴ The chance to acquire the existing Weapon Cores by defeating Normal/Commander monsters remains unchanged. You can now acquire Hit Augmentation Cores (Variant AB) additionally.

ㄴ As for Void Erosion Purge: Challenge Difficulty, Hit Augmentation Core (Variant AB) was not added as its reward as many Descendants have already acquired rewards.

 

Void Intercept Battle: Challenge

– Void Intercept Battle: Challenge has been added. Colossus appearing in the Challenge difficulty are much more formidable.

– Void Intercept Battle: Challenge features Ice Maiden. To intercept this Ice Maiden, you must clear “The Most Powerful Colossus Intercept Battle” Quest first.

– Void Intercept Battle: Challenge only supports private matchmaking.

– Added the Exchange Past Attendance Rewards function.

ㄴ You can exchange the attendance rewards of the days you missed by consuming “Attendance Memento” item.

ㄴ Redeemable attendance days are the days after the beginning of the event but you failed to log in.

ㄴ (Example) It’s day 5 of the event, and you only made to day 3 attendance.

ㆍ You may exchange day 4 and day 5 attendance rewards.

ㆍ After exchanging rewards, you start counting from day 6 attendance.

ㄴ This function will be applied to the new Login Event.

ㆍ Not applied: “Albion Special Dispatch” Login Event

– Shortened the standby time for the commencement of Intercept Battles.

– Brought the starting location of some Intercept Battles closer to the Colossus spawn point.

– Fixed to deduct Death Count individually in all difficulties of Void Intercept Battles.

– When Death Count runs out, the player enters an indefinite DBNO state without time limit. Resurrection is not available, but you may be rescued by another player.

– Combined Void Intercept Battle icons that were scattered across the Map UI and different by difficulty level to one single icon.

ㄴ Improved it to be displayed as a fixed icon at the bottom of the Map UI. When clicked, icons of different difficulties pan out.
